#566404 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#566404 is composed of 33.7% red, 39.2% green and 1.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 14% cyan, 0% magenta, 96% yellow and 60.8% black. It has a hue angle of 68.8 degrees, a saturation of 92.3% and a lightness of 20.4%. #566404 color hex could be obtained by blending #acc808 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#666600.

Shades and Tints of #566404
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#050600 is the darkest color, while #fdfef2 is the lightest one.

Tones of #566404
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#373830 is the less saturated color, while #596800 is the most saturated one.
